Frequently Asked Questions


JEPQ and SVOL have a correlation of 0.77, meaning they provide meaningful diversification benefit when combined. Depending on your allocation goals, holding both could reduce overall portfolio risk.

JEPQ has higher volatility (5.89%) compared to SVOL (3.40%). In terms of maximum drawdown, JEPQ dropped -20.07% vs SVOL's -33.50%.

On 3-year performance, JEPQ leads with 19.03% vs 6.26% for SVOL. On fees, JEPQ is cheaper at 0.35% per year. On volatility, SVOL has been the lower-risk option at 3.40%. The better choice depends on whether you care most about return, fees, risk, or income.

Over the 3-year period, JEPQ has performed better with a 19.03% return vs 6.26%. Past performance does not guarantee future results, so compare this with risk, fees, and fund exposure.

JEPQ is cheaper with a 0.35% expense ratio, compared with 0.50% for SVOL.

SVOL has the higher dividend yield at 21.66%, compared with 10.50% for JEPQ.

JEPQ is categorized as Nasdaq-100, while SVOL is Volatility. They also come from different issuers: JPMorgan and Simplify. Their fees differ too: 0.35% for JEPQ and 0.50% for SVOL.
